Saint George is a waterfront neighborhood known for its proximity to Staten Island Ferry service, making it accessible to Manhattan. The area features a mix of residential buildings, with currently 312+ buildings available for rent. The average building rating here is 2.9/5, based on 6 rated buildings, indicating varied experiences among tenants. What to check before for buildings with low eviction rates in Saint George

  • Expect a stable living environment with lower tenancy turnover and eviction rates.
  • Always confirm lease terms, particularly any fees associated with leases, like deposits or application fees.
  • Check the building's history of evictions through tenant reviews and data before leasing.
  • Ask property management about the building's policy regarding evictions and tenant support services.
  • Note that while low-evictions is a positive sign, individual experiences may vary.
  • Prepare to consider additional costs that may occur, such as utilities and maintenance fees.
